Initialism for "suck my dick"
by qwerty-space September 09, 2017
by ethanmlego July 10, 2019
by rokyyyyyy August 15, 2019
Someone who is popular on YouTube for car audio and gets off rubbing in his fortunes to his loyal followers about how much money he has while thinking he contributes to the industry.
by Mrs. Snacks July 20, 2017
SMD means suck my dick
by BurgerzCALLOFDEATH September 25, 2023